Literature summary for 3.1.1.11 extracted from

  • Terefe, N.S.; Delele, M.A.; Van Loey, A.; Hendrickx, M.
    Effects of cryostabilizers, low temperature, and freezing on the kinetics of the pectin methylesterase-catalyzed de-esterification of pectin (2005), J. Agric. Food Chem., 53, 2282-2288.
    View publication on PubMed

Application

Application Comment Organism
food industry destabilizes pectinaceous materials in fruit juices and concentrates and modifies the texture of fruit and vegetable products Solanum lycopersicum

General Stability

General Stability Organism
loss of activity in concentrated maltodextrin or sucrose solutions Solanum lycopersicum
